What does any of this cost? Nothing. Every format listed is a free download. One practical note: save the file and open it in a desktop pdf reader, because browser previews often ignore interactive fields and lose what you typed.

Where do you start? At the top. Identification first, the substance of the entry second, certification last. Why that order? Because fields lower on the page often depend on data you established in the header, and filling out of sequence produces contradictions.

Why does the edition matter so much here? Because DD forms are revised centrally. When the Department reissues one, it reissues it for all branches simultaneously, and the field layout can shift. Compare the printed date against not stated before you type anything.

What about a box that does not apply to you? Enter N/A rather than leaving it empty. An empty field reads as an oversight and sends the form back; N/A reads as an answer. What about dates? Use the format printed beside the field, not the one you write by habit.

Why read the Privacy Act Statement? Because it sits ahead of the personal data fields deliberately. It names the collection authority, the principal purpose, the routine uses of your data and the consequence of declining. Reading it afterward tells you nothing you can still act on.

How do you sign electronically? With a digital signature, usually CAC-based, in a reader that handles it. Will typing your name work? Not as execution — it fills a field without certifying anything. Either way, the date goes in immediately after.

What sends forms back most often? An obsolete edition, blank required boxes, handwriting illegible after scanning, dates in a format the form did not ask for, and certification without a signature or without a date.
